Output 66d07001d087cbb3b45fba513c332c17e2cbed56873eacfd08c801edefe8bd53:5

value
280911158
script pubkey
OP_0 OP_PUSHBYTES_20 59623fabaeebb8824bf63df6f888fb74c2370c94
address
bc1qt93rl2awawugyjlk8hm03z8mwnprwry5zjn9tf
transaction
66d07001d087cbb3b45fba513c332c17e2cbed56873eacfd08c801edefe8bd53
spent
true